Since most of the original farmers and commoners of Puerto Rico between the 15th and 18th centuries came from Andalusia (Andaluca), the basis for most of Puerto Rican Spanish is Andalusian Spanish (particularly that of Seville) (Sevilla). In North America, the species has a southeastern distribution, from the Carolinas to Texas, but strays northward along the Atlantic Coast as far as coastal New York, and inland as far north as Kentucky and Arkansas. For example, the endings -ado, -ido, -edo often drop intervocalic /d/ in both Seville and San Juan: hablado > hablao, vendido > vendo, dedo > deo (intervocalic /d/ dropping is quite widespread in coastal American dialects). The Spanish moth, originally described from Surinam, is found throughout lowland areas of South and Central America, and in the Caribbean.
